A Kissimmee man was involved in a fatal crash Friday in Orange County that killed an Apopka motorcyclist.

According to Florida Highway Patrol reports, Christopher Hudmon, 52, of Kissimmee, was driving a 2002 Ford van eastbound on Lee Road at about 8:45 a.m. Meanwhile, Luis Escalera, 21, of Apopka, was driving a 2011 Yamaha motorcycle westbound on Lee Road in the center lane, exceeding the speed limit, Highway Patrol reports said.

Hudmon then drove into the left lane to turn north onto Edgewater Drive. As he attempted to make the left turn, he drove into the path of Escalera, reports said. The front of the motorcycle struck the rear of the van.

Escalera was taken to Florida Hospital South where he was pronounced dead. Hudmon was not injured.  

The crash remains under investigation and charges are pending.
